Philippines - Import of Salted, Dried or Smoked Swine Hams and Shoulders

Since 2013, Philippines Import of Salted, Dried or Smoked Swine Hams and Shoulders grew 190% year on year. In 2018, the country was ranked number 88 among other countries in Import of Salted, Dried or Smoked Swine Hams and Shoulders at $24,204. Philippines is overtaken by Kazakhstan, which was ranked number 87 with $24,286.11 and is followed by Qatar at $23,306.3. Canada topped the ranking with $51,287,064 in 2019, a decrease of 4.3% compared to 2018. France, United States and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Nicaragua witnessed the best average annual growth at +305.1% per year, while Russia was the worst growing country at -84.8% per year.
